Output 59740cf8c33e7ee03b80dfccadab682638d57532740474e72b8a10c12f76859d:1

value
1160954
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1bdd264f4b0340018ec42883365c5f2b98a36f2e OP_EQUAL
address
MASVQMdVQfTjDpVJAjUD27b8RChTPH8xUa
transaction
59740cf8c33e7ee03b80dfccadab682638d57532740474e72b8a10c12f76859d
spent
true